A Domain Decomposition Method Based on Mortar Elements for Incompressible Navier-Stokes Equations

Abstract: At first,the domain decomposition method based on mortar element is introduced briefly,which takes advantage of the variational principles and is well suitable for finite element approximation.Then,the emphasis is put on the application to the solution of Navier-Stokes equations for incompressible viscous flow,including construction of the equivalent variational formulation,time discretization by operator splitting,conjugate gradient iterative solution to the generalized Stoke problem with domain decomposition and finite element approximation.Finally,the results of numerical experiments validate the application of this domain decomposition method to the incompressible Navier-Stokes equations.

Key words: domain decomposition, mortar element, incompressible viscous flow, Navier-Stokes equations, finite element
